Montana State University to host Lego robotics competitions Feb 6-7
WHEN: Friday, Feb. 6, and Saturday, Feb. 7
WHERE: MSU’s Shroyer Gym, MSU’s Norm Asbjornson Hall
WHAT: Robotics competition
Members of the Montana media,
Montana State University invites you to cover an annual exercise in STEM – science, technology, engineering and math – in which more than 400 K-12 students from across the state show off robots they engineered and built using Lego robotic kits and more advanced metal construction systems with 3D printed parts, motors, sensors and custom programming. Media will have the opportunity to photograph and take video of the participants and their robots in action.
The FIRST Tech Challenge, a competition featuring students from grades 7-12, will take place Friday, Feb. 6, in MSU’s Shroyer Gym. The FIRST Lego League, a competition featuring students from grades K-8, will take place Saturday, Feb. 7, in MSU’s Inspiration Hall within Norm Asbjornson Hall.
